Does Nebraska Medicaid have new work requirements?

Nebraska Medicaid is adding work requirements in 2026. Adults ages 19 and 64 may need to complete at least 80 hours of approved activities in a month to keep their coverage.

Starting May 1, 2026, Nebraska Medicaid will have work requirements for some adults ages 19 to 64. If you're affected, you'll need to complete at least 80 hours in a month of approved activities. 

These may include:

  • Work.
  • School (going to an accredited school at least half-time, based on your school's definition of half-time enrollment).
  • An apprenticeship.
  • Volunteer activities. 

The Nebraska Department of Health and Human Services (DHHS) manages the program and decides who needs to meet the requirement.
